1. A neighbor cell configuration method, comprising:

  • obtaining, by a femtocell base station, information of at least one macro cell through demodulating radio signals detected by a receiver;

    obtaining, by the femtocell base station, neighbor cell information of the at least one macro cell;

    generating, by the femtocell base station, a neighbor cell configuration list through adding the information of the at least one macro cell and all or part of the neighbor cell information of the at least one macro cell to the neighbor cell configuration list; and

    performing, by the femtocell base station, neighbor cell configuration according to the neighbor cell configuration list;

    optimizing, by the femtocell base station, the neighbor cell configuration list if the number of neighbor cells in the neighbor cell configuration list is above a predetermined threshold; and

    performing, by the femtocell base station, neighbor cell configuration according to the optimized neighbor cell configuration list;

    wherein the optimizing comprises;

    setting a neighbor cell optimization condition, the neighbor cell optimization condition comprising an optimization time T and the number of handovers N;

    generating a target cell list through collecting target cells included in a relocation message used for a handover of a UE in a given time T1; and

    comparing the neighbor cell configuration list and the target cell list and deleting cells which are in the neighbor cell configuration list and are not target cells in the target cell list to generate an optimized neighbor cell configuration list, when the neighbor cell optimization condition is satisfied, which is that the given time T1 for collecting the target cells reaches the optimization time T and the number of handovers M equals to the number of handovers N wherein the number of handovers M is calculated by adding up handovers of UEs within the given time T1.
